Transaction 0727e852e71668c342659489818878ebd8e45860f92c595d8378ddbfaee52a63
1 Input
2 Outputs
- 0727e852e71668c342659489818878ebd8e45860f92c595d8378ddbfaee52a63:0
- 0727e852e71668c342659489818878ebd8e45860f92c595d8378ddbfaee52a63:1
value 1004723
address 3CHQkXzMvK54BqWuQzfGYuqrqTKUp2XLdL
value 2992598
address 3PJPaxx3e7SkPJKJJYFjMhb6J3Twyubeug